Anggrek Dendrobium: A Stunning Orchid Variety

Orchids have always fascinated plant enthusiasts due to their diverse forms, colors, and elegance. Among the many species, anggrek dendrobium stands out as one of the most cherished types. Native to Southeast Asia, this orchid species captivates gardeners and collectors alike with its striking appearance and relatively easy care compared to other exotic orchids.

Dendrobium orchids come in a variety of shapes and shades, ranging from delicate whites to vibrant purples and pinks. These blooms are not only visually appealing but also have cultural significance in many countries. For instance, in Indonesia and Thailand, anggrek dendrobium is often used in ceremonies and as ornamental gifts.

Characteristics of Anggrek Dendrobium

Understanding the unique characteristics of anggrek dendrobium can help both beginners and experienced growers maintain healthy plants. Some key features include:

Flower Structure

Anggrek dendrobium produces clusters of flowers that often grow along tall, slender stems. Each bloom typically has five petals and a distinct lip, which acts as a landing platform for pollinators. Depending on the variety, flowers can be single-colored or multi-toned, sometimes displaying patterns or stripes.

Growth Habit

Unlike some orchids that require specific environments, dendrobiums are versatile. They can grow in pots, hanging baskets, or mounted on tree bark. This adaptability makes them suitable for indoor and outdoor cultivation in tropical and subtropical regions.

Lifespan and Blooming

Dendrobium orchids are known for their longevity. With proper care, the plant can live for several years, producing blooms annually. The flowering period varies among species, but many anggrek dendrobium orchids display their colorful blossoms for several weeks at a time.

How to Care for Anggrek Dendrobium

Proper care is crucial to ensure healthy growth and frequent flowering. Here’s a detailed guide to maintaining your anggrek dendrobium:

Light Requirements

Dendrobiums thrive in bright, indirect sunlight. Too much direct sunlight can scorch the leaves, while insufficient light may prevent flowering. A location near a window with filtered sunlight is ideal.

Watering and Humidity

Watering should be done carefully to avoid root rot. Typically, watering once a week is sufficient, allowing the medium to dry slightly between waterings. High humidity levels (around 50–70%) are favorable for optimal growth. Using a humidity tray or misting the plant can help maintain the right environment.

Soil and Potting

Dendrobiums require well-draining media, such as a mix of bark, perlite, and sphagnum moss. Good drainage ensures that roots are not waterlogged, which can lead to fungal infections. Repotting every two years helps provide fresh nutrients and encourages new growth.

Fertilization

Regular feeding supports robust growth and flowering. Use a balanced orchid fertilizer diluted to half strength every two weeks during the growing season. Reducing fertilization in winter helps the plant rest and prepare for the next bloom cycle.

Tips for Successful Blooming

To encourage more frequent and vibrant blooms:

  1. Provide sufficient indirect light and avoid overcrowding.

  2. Maintain consistent watering without overwatering.

  3. Ensure proper air circulation to prevent pests and diseases.

  4. Fertilize regularly during the growing season and reduce feeding during dormancy.

By following these simple tips, your anggrek dendrobium can thrive and showcase its stunning flowers year after year.
